On Thu, 23 Mar 2023 23:24:22 +0800
Heng Qi <hengqi@linux.alibaba.com> wrote:

> +struct virtio_net_ctrl_coal_vq {
> +    le16 vqn;
> +    le16 reserved;
> +    struct virtio_net_ctrl_coal coal;
> +};
> +
>  #define VIRTIO_NET_CTRL_NOTF_COAL 6
>   #define VIRTIO_NET_CTRL_NOTF_COAL_TX_SET  0
>   #define VIRTIO_NET_CTRL_NOTF_COAL_RX_SET 1
> + #define VIRTIO_NET_CTRL_NOTF_COAL_VQ_SET 2
> + #define VIRTIO_NET_CTRL_NOTF_COAL_VQ_GET 3
>  \end{lstlisting}
>  
>  Coalescing parameters:
>  \begin{itemize}
> +\item \field{vqn}: The virtqueue number of an enabled transmit or receive virtqueue.

Just to be on the safe side: VIRTIO_F_NOTIF_CONFIG_DATA has been
negotiated, and queue_select != queue_notify_data, is vqn supposed
to contain queue_notify_data or the number/index that is used for
queue_select (I'm talking about the PCI transport case)?
